Review – Guardians of the Galaxy Posted on November 12, 2021 by Todd Eggleston Leave a comment Square Enix hit us with its best shot. Read more Review
Review – Telltale’s Guardians of the Galaxy Episode I: Tangled Up in Blue Posted on June 5, 2017 by Leo Faria One comment Ooga Chaka Ooga Ooga Ooga Chaka Read more Review